Traditional SEO targets ranked links on a results page. Answer Engine Optimization targets something different: the AI-generated responses that now appear before those links, or replace them entirely.
When a buyer asks ChatGPT "what's the best compliance software for cannabis dispensaries," the answer engine doesn't return ten blue links. It returns one or two paragraphs, usually with one or two brand mentions. Getting into those paragraphs requires entity signals, structured data, question-answer architecture, and content that AI systems recognize as authoritative on a specific topic.
